I have come to a final conclusion on the TIE lesson & voice thread activity. It is a story-mapping & sequencing lesson on the book There Was An Old Lady Who Swallowed A Fly. The students will be put in groups to each work on finding a part assigned to them, such as; setting, characters, problem, three major events, and a solution. After the groups each take turns providing the answer for their parts and explaining they will each be given a copy of a story map to fill out, they can choose together or work alone. The students can choose to work together on this or alone. The filled out story-maps will be depicted on the voice thread. Students can use the voice thread to comment on each other's work or use the "doodle" tool to circle things that interest them. Below are links of everything that goes with my lesson.
